If you are interested in charging a 220Ah battery using solar panels, there are several important factors to consider. First and foremost, the efficiency of your solar panels plays a crucial role in this process. Typically, solar panels have an efficiency range of 15-20%, which means they can convert only a certain percentage of sunlight into electricity. For the purpose of this calculation, let's assume that your solar panels have an efficiency of 18%.
Additionally, it is essential to determine the rated power output of each panel. Let's assume that each panel generates 250 watts of power. To determine the number of panels required, you need to divide the total wattage needed (in this case, approximately 220Ah x 12V = 2640 watts) by the wattage output per panel (250 watts). Based on these calculations, you would need approximately eleven solar panels to effectively charge a single 220Ah battery.
However, it is important to note that these calculations are estimates and may vary depending on actual conditions such as weather patterns and geographical location.
